MONTREAL—The condo buildings along the Lachine Canal are new, the grass and flowers are freshly planted, the asphalt on Philippe-Lalonde St. is clean.

What could be responsible for a midnight fire that gutted three condo units? Fire investigators have a theory: someone carelessly smoking on their terrace.

A four-alarm fire broke out in the St-Ambroise area at 12:10 a.m. Wednesday on the third-floor terrace of 5160 Philippe-Lalonde St. With the three-storey condo building connected to its neighbour, the fire department responded quickly with 80 firefighters.

Thirty residents had to be evacuated from the building. No injuries were reported and the fire was under control by about 3:30 a.m.
